数据库软件是什么格式的

worktile 其他 4

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    数据库软件可以有多种格式,以下是一些常见的数据库软件格式:

    1. 关系型数据库软件:关系型数据库软件使用表格的形式来存储和管理数据,最常见的关系型数据库软件是MySQL、Oracle、Microsoft SQL Server和PostgreSQL等。这些软件使用结构化查询语言(SQL)来操作和查询数据。

    2. 非关系型数据库软件:非关系型数据库软件也被称为NoSQL数据库软件,它们使用不同的数据模型来存储数据。常见的非关系型数据库软件包括MongoDB、Cassandra和Redis等。这些软件适用于需要处理大量非结构化数据的应用场景。

    3. 图数据库软件:图数据库软件专门用于存储和处理图结构的数据,例如社交网络关系、知识图谱等。常见的图数据库软件包括Neo4j、OrientDB和ArangoDB等。

    4. 列式数据库软件:列式数据库软件将数据按列存储,而不是按行存储。这种存储方式在需要高效地进行聚合查询和分析时非常有优势。HBase和Cassandra都是列式数据库软件的代表。

    5. 内存数据库软件:内存数据库软件将数据存储在内存中,而不是磁盘上,以实现更快的数据访问速度。常见的内存数据库软件有Redis、Memcached和SAP HANA等。

    这些数据库软件格式各有特点和适用场景,根据具体的需求和应用场景选择合适的数据库软件格式非常重要。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    数据库软件可以存在多种格式,这取决于不同的数据库管理系统(DBMS)。下面介绍几种常见的数据库软件格式。

    1. 关系型数据库软件(RDBMS):关系型数据库软件以表格的形式存储数据。最常见的关系型数据库软件是Oracle、MySQL、Microsoft SQL Server、PostgreSQL等。这些软件使用结构化查询语言(SQL)来管理和操作数据,支持事务处理和数据一致性。

    2. 非关系型数据库软件(NoSQL):非关系型数据库软件以非结构化或半结构化的形式存储数据,适用于大数据和分布式环境。常见的非关系型数据库软件包括MongoDB、Cassandra、Redis、CouchDB等。这些软件使用不同的数据模型,如键值对、文档、列族、图形等。

    3. 嵌入式数据库软件:嵌入式数据库软件被嵌入到应用程序中,以提供本地数据存储和管理功能。它们通常以文件的形式存储数据,可以在应用程序内部直接访问和操作。常见的嵌入式数据库软件包括SQLite、Berkeley DB等。

    4. 内存数据库软件:内存数据库软件将数据存储在内存中,以提供高速数据访问和处理能力。这些软件适用于对读写性能要求较高的应用场景,如金融交易、实时分析等。常见的内存数据库软件包括Redis、Memcached、SAP HANA等。

    总之,数据库软件的格式取决于所使用的数据库管理系统和数据模型。不同的数据库软件提供不同的功能和性能特点,可以根据具体的需求选择适合的数据库软件格式。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    数据库软件并没有固定的格式,它们可以是不同的文件格式或数据存储结构。下面是常见的数据库软件及其相应的文件格式或数据存储结构:

    1. MySQL:MySQL是一种关系型数据库管理系统,它使用自己的文件格式来存储数据。MySQL的数据文件通常具有以".frm"结尾的表定义文件,以及以".ibd"结尾的InnoDB存储引擎数据文件。

    2. Oracle:Oracle是一种功能强大的关系型数据库管理系统。它使用自己的文件格式来存储数据,包括控制文件、数据文件、日志文件和参数文件等。

    3. Microsoft SQL Server:Microsoft SQL Server也是一种关系型数据库管理系统,它使用自己的文件格式来存储数据。SQL Server的数据文件通常具有以".mdf"结尾的主数据文件和以".ldf"结尾的日志文件。

    4. PostgreSQL:PostgreSQL是一种开源的关系型数据库管理系统,它使用自己的文件格式来存储数据。PostgreSQL的数据文件通常具有以".dat"结尾的数据文件和以".conf"结尾的配置文件。

    5. MongoDB:MongoDB是一种NoSQL数据库,它使用一种称为BSON(Binary JSON)的二进制格式来存储数据。BSON是一种类似于JSON的文档存储格式,可以将数据以文档的形式存储在集合中。

    需要注意的是,不同数据库软件的文件格式和数据存储结构可能会有所不同。此外,数据库软件还可以使用其他的存储方式,比如内存数据库可以将数据存储在内存中,而不是磁盘上的文件。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部